(Pousse D'or Corton Clos du Roi) #1; COLOR-medium; NOSE-really ripe dark cherry; not the classic barnyard; very young and vibrant; a floral aspect as well; PALATE-very, very young; really bitter on the back-end; a little disjointed; but you can't deny the power and that this is going somewhere; the elements are in place to be good in the future; the fruit is very pure and focused; the structure on the mid-palate is shockingly good; the transition of the upfront black cherry fruit to the green, floral component is seamless; easily 12-18 years of cellaring; this real shows a ton of potential; a slight cocoa component; also a sun dried tomato component on the back-end; great wine; look forward to seeing where this wine goes; AM-93; GV-91?
(Pousse d'Or Corton Clos du Roi) Medium colour. Ripe red fruit is backed by a little darker oak. The fruit gives a slightly roast impression but the structure and the finish are very good. Very good.
